#21c4c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#21c4c0 is composed of 12.9% red, 76.9%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 2%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 178.5 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 44.9%. #21c4c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#42ffff with #008981.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#21c4c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#21c4c0 has RGB values of R:33, G:196,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 2213056.

Shades and Tints of #21c4c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b0b is the darkest color, while #fafef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#21c4c0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707575 is the less saturated color, while #07ded9 is the most saturated one.
